Three Staff Resignations, Two Teaching Contracts Approved by APS Board of Ed

Monday night, April 12, the Auburn Public Schools (APS) Board of Education accepted three teacher resignations while hiring two new instructors.

Leaving APS will be Diana Eickhoff, Bryce Roth and Matthew Stubbs. Eickhoff, 12th grade English teacher and Bulldog speech coach, is retiring. Roth, ninth through 12th grade teacher, is accepting a teaching position with Milford Public Schools. Stubbs, instrumental music director, will be taking a similar position at Minden Public Schools. Roth and Stubbs will be returning to their respective hometowns.

Contracts were approved with Cassandra Eickhoff as ninth through 12th grade social studies teacher and Ben Hanika as instrumental music instructor. Hanika, who taught at APS from 2014 through 2017, returns after four years at Educational Service Unit (ESU) 4 as technology integration specialist.
